# Approvals: Proctorline Exam Queue

All changes to the Proctorline queue worker require one approval before merge. Flagged exam sessions auto-escalate after 20 minutes unsanctioned. Do not bypass the fairness shuffler; it is audited quarterly. Rollbacks need a paired approval plus a note in the sync doc. Escalations outside business hours page the on-call. Final approval authority for queue config rests with the person below.

named custodian: Belius Casath Ulaix Sorius

DETECT_CONFIDENCE_MIN (default 0.80) controls when
# we fall back to UTF-8 with replacement. Reviewers: note that
# lowering this below 0.6 reintroduces the mojibake regression
# from release 12. DETECT_SAMPLE_BYTES caps how much of the
# file is sniffed; 64KB is plenty.
#
# The detection sidecar authenticates with a shared secret,
# declared on the next line.

vault entry, yahif-yajep: COURIER_KEY29=b802bdf8034096b65a51c6ba5abe2

Partition maintenance for Ledgerline's archive tables runs monthly. Before adding the next month's partition, confirm the previous one sealed cleanly and that the retention sweep finished without errors. Never drop a partition manually; the janitor job handles detachment and archival in order. The partitioning service reads the following configuration at startup.

settings of fafog-haduf:
ZORIX_PIN=4648
ZORIX_METRICS_HOST=metrics.zorix.paliqsys.corp
ZORIX_LOG_LEVEL=info
ZORIX_TENANT=druix